Speaker and Facilitator
Stephen B. Page is an Associate Professor at the Evans School of Public Affairs at the
University of Washington and Faculty Director of the Executive MPA Program. He joined the Evans School faculty in 1999. His research studies changes in policies, administration, and service delivery arrangements within and across the public and non-governmental sectors over time, with specific attention to dilemmas of collaboration, accountability, and performance.
Discussion Topics:
• There has been a reset in human services, and our funding and operational environment is very different from what it was 20 years ago. Our organizations have had to implement change.
• How do we meet the challenges that (we feel) force us to change, and the opportunities that present themselves with these changes?
• How do we create a culture of change, so that our staff can adjust to changes that have occurred and changes to come? How do we implement sustainable changes?
